More often than not, there’s a stylist behind a celebrity’s fabulous red carpet look and/or fierce street style. Yes, there are a lot of celebs with an innate sense of great style (looking at you, Blake Lively) who don’t need help. However, style isn’t everyone’s thing, and often, celebrities don’t have the time to pull a wardrobe together. That’s where celebrity stylists come in and we’ve picked ten that we think are at the top of their game.

ROB ZANGARDI

Dressing red carpet queen Jennifer Lopez is no easy feat, and Rob Zangardi has nailed it ever since they began working together in 2010. Zangardi first appeared on the celeb stylist radar when he teamed up with fellow stylist Mariel Haenn for Rihanna’s “Umbrella” video in 2007. Since then, he and J-Lo have repeatedly upped the ante when it comes to dressing for red carpets and performances. Remember J-Lo’s show-stopping studded leather bodysuit she wore for her Superbowl halftime performance? Oh, and not to mention the costumes for the entire halftime show production? Enough said.

JUNE AMBROSE

Remember Missy Elliott’s iconic blown-up black patent leather & vinyl outfit in her “The Rain (Supa Dupa Fly)” video? We have June Ambrose to thank for that. Her career has continued to blossom and now she is most known for taking rapper Jay-Z’s style from street to sleek. In addition to creating some of rap superstars’ most well-known looks, her resume expands into dressing Hollywood. Other clients include Kerry Washington, Zoe Saldana and Gabrielle Union.

JASON REMBERT

Zayn Malik’s robotic arm at the 2016 Met Gala,  Odell Beckham Jr.’s recent sleek style switch and Rita Ora’s looks the last seven years are all the work of stylist Jason Rembert.  He got his start in the fashion closet at W Magazine and eventually teamed up with Alicia Keys’ stylist Wouri Vice to work on looks for Keys’ album. He now lists Gucci Mane, Nicki Minaj and Issa Rae as clients and recently debuted his fashion collection, Aliétte.

MONICA ROSE

Celeb stylist Monica Rose got her big break after meeting Kim Kardashian on a shoot in 2007. Since then, she’s been responsible for almost a decade of Kardashian family fashion. She even managed to create a trademark aesthetic in celebrity street style culture that has saturated the web and social media in recent years: monochromatic, nude tones, body-conscious, crop top, big duster coat – you know the look. Although she no longer styles the Kardashians, she still has an impressive roster of clients, including Chanel Iman, Chrissy Teigen and Cara Delevigne.

KATE YOUNG

Considering Kate Young survived working as an assistant for Anna Wintour, it’s no wonder she’s now at the top of her game. As Wintour’s assistant, Young worked on countless fashion shoots and met tons of celebs and publicists. She eventually became the creative mind behind red carpet powerhouses such as Sienna Miller, Margot Robbie and Dakota Johnson. Young’s specialty is balancing elegance, ease and never forgetting to have fun.

LAW ROACH

Arguably one of the top celebrity stylists in the world right now, Law Roach is simply unstoppable. He dresses none other than Zendaya – one of the best-dressed actresses on any red carpet. He also served as a judge on America’s Next Top Model from 2016-2018 and currently judges the HBO Max show Legendary, alongside Megan Thee Stallion, Leiomy Maldonado and Jameela Jamil. Roach is the one behind Celine Dion’s mega-transformation and he also dresses Ariana Grande and Priyanka Chopra.  He recently became the first Black stylist featured on the cover of the annual “Stylists and Stars” issue of The Hollywood Reporter.

MIMI CUTTRELL

At just 28 years old, Mimi Cuttrell is already a big-name stylist. If you’ve seen any of the jaw-dropping looks worn by Gigi and Bella Hadid, you’ve seen Cuttrell’s work. Other names make it clear that Cuttrell’s the go-to for the “It Girl” set:  Lily-Rose Depp and blogger Camila Coelho are two examples. A stickler for the underrated categories of tailoring and details, Cuttrell makes sure that every look she creates is always red-carpet ready.

KARLA WELCH

For the 2019 Oscars, Canadian super stylist Karla Welch styled 20 looks alone. For Tracee Ellis Ross’ 2018 American Music Awards hosting gig, Welch (who dressed Ross in twelve looks) only used Black designers, including Pyer Moss, Sergio Hudson, Nicolas Jebran and Dapper Dan for Gucci. On top of all of that, her clothing collection, x Karla, has collaborated with well-known brands like Hanes, Dockers and Levi’s – the last of which sold out in less than 24 hours and raised over $1 million for gun safety.

MICAELA ERLANGER

You’ve probably heard her name before.  Micaela Erlanger is responsible for Lupita Nyongo’s knockout ensembles for her 2018 Black Panther press tour. She’s also the creative mind behind Crazy Rich Asians star Constance Wu’s breathtaking looks for the film’s premiere and subsequent awards season. From the Ralph & Russo movie premiere gown that went viral, to an amazing custom-made pleated tulle (yes, pleated tulle, aka next to impossible) Versace dress that Wu wore to that year’s Oscars. Erlanger has elevated Wu’s style through her styling expertise.

PETRA FLANNERY

Petra Flannery topped The Hollywood Reporter’s list of top stylists back in 2015 and she has shown no sign of slowing down. She had the pleasure of juggling both Emma Stone and Amy Adams for their 2018 awards show seasons (Stone for The Favourite and Adams for Vice) and ended up turning out over 100 looks for the pair in just two months. Fun fact: for the Oscars that year, Flannery received a gift from the fashion gods, with Stone and Adams at the same hotel – literally across the hall from each other. We’d say that probably saved her more than a few strands of pulled-out hair.
